Granville Center hosts Easter contest


Granville Center on Madison Street in Granville, New York, had a fun and exciting Easter Sunday as the 122-bed skilled nursing facility threw a fun Easter basket contest for the residents. Included with a number of winners were 76-year-old Fort Anne native Linda White (left) and Robert Wells, 71, (right), originally from Hudson Falls. Mr. Wells did something very beautiful as he donated his winning basket to one very special pre-K student from Mary J. Tanner Elementary School of the Granville Central School District who often comes to visit Robert. Says Robert, “My buddy Abe always comes to visit me, and every child should receive a gift from the Easter Bunny.”
